The LLC agreement in Huggins included a “shotgun” style buy-sell provision triggered by a disagreement “on any matter” continuing for 30 days, allowing (but not requiring) either member to deliver a buy-sell notice giving the other member the choice to buy or sell her interest at the price given in the notice.
